Rove City Centre evinces Dubai's urbanized milieu
Published in The Saudi Gazette on 08 - 12 - 2016

HAVING redefined the midscale hospitality experience in Dubai, Rove Hotels, a contemporary mid-scale lifestyle hotel brand developed by Emaar Hospitality Group, has opened its second property in Dubai in the heart of the city assuring an authentic, novel, and culturally stimulating hospitality experience.
Rove City Centre, under Rove Hotels, a joint venture of Emaar Properties and Meraas Holding, opens following the successful launch of Rove Downtown Dubai, next to The Dubai Mall and the Dubai International Financial Centre. Seven Rove Hotels have been announced with another three more to open by 2020 taking the total number of Rove Hotels in Dubai to 10, adding a total of over 3,700 rooms, just in time to support Expo 2020 Dubai.
With a distinctive design palette and a brand-new art showcase that draws inspiration from its surroundings yet being true to the Rove Hotels brand values, Rove City Centre has a distinctive location in Deira by the historic Dubai Creek, only 10 minutes from the Dubai International Airport, and in walking distance of City Centre Deira and the Dubai Creek & Yacht Club.
Featuring bustling souks to modern malls and serving as home to several governmental head offices, Deira is a vibrant hub of the city. The close proximity to the airport and the rich cultural experiences that await guests make it an ideal location for Rove City Centre.
The 270-room highly design-influenced hotel, that will especially appeal to culturally inclined travellers as well as business guests, opens to spectacular views of Dubai's original trade hub by Dubai Creek. It is set in a highly engaging location defined by the souks, historic houses and traditional dhows that underline Dubai's cultural identity.
